How often should pool cartridge be cleaned?
every two to six weeks
Typically, cartridge filters need to be cleaned every two to six weeks. One of the most important factors that affect a cartridge filter operating effectively is that there not be too much flow through the filter.
Can you clean a pool filter with dish soap?
You can purchase pool filter cleaner, but some pool owners choose to make their own. One method is to fill a bucket with warm water so that it’s deep enough for the cartridge to be completely submerged. Then, add one cup of liquid dish soap or dishwasher detergent for every five gallons of water.
How long do cartridge pool filters last?
3 to 5 years
Typically, cartridge filters need to be replaced every 3 to 5 years. You can also tell your cartridge filter needs to be swapped out if you start having to clean it more often; that is, if the pressure gauge increases by 8 PSI much more often than every 6 months, you may need to replace it.

Do you have to backwash a cartridge pool filter?
Cartridge pool filters cannot be backwashed and must be cleaned by hand. Because they were not built for reverse water flow, cartridge filters can’t be “backwashed” simply by reversing the water flow in the pool’s filter system. These filters must be cleaned by hand when they are dirty.

How do you change filter cartridges on Pentair?
Replace Cartridges: Place each filter 1-4 on a corresponding spot on the bottom manifold. The cartridge should slide over the coupler and slightly snap when you press down firmly. When in position the 4 cartridges should stand vertically at the same height without falling over.
What’s the best way to clean Pentair cartridges?
Cleaning the Cartridges; If the cartridges look good, soak them in a bucket of 20:1 water:muriatic-acid solution until the solution stops bubbling. I alternate them in while cleaning. Using a high-pressure nozzle attached to a garden hose, or a pressure washer, clean deeply into each pleat from top to bottom.
How big is a Pentair clean and clear plus?
The Pentair Clean and Clear Plus ranges from 240 square feet to 520 square feet. The only difference between the sizes is the height of the outside body which directly correlates with the length of the cartridges inside. So, splitting the tank on each will be exactly the same.

How is the filter secured on a Pentair cartridge filter?
The fiberglass-reinforced tank halves are secured with an innovative clamp ring—just loosen the ring and remove the top half for easy cartridge access and rinsing. Filter maintenance doesn’t get any easier.
